Transaction 42919bae65acca0a7433163c1322e52f91d714ff50f1a761be9d08e556205746

21 Input
2 Outputs
  • 42919bae65acca0a7433163c1322e52f91d714ff50f1a761be9d08e556205746:0
  • value  142984
    address  3R2Wuy5LkcbQ43dTfUQCBR2j1twnkwziD2
  • 42919bae65acca0a7433163c1322e52f91d714ff50f1a761be9d08e556205746:1
  • value  100000020
    address  36xGmZANX4dFaHCEKJdA2A5zK6bZXYaktk